The Modern Education School (MES) was established in 1997 by El-Shark Company, Chairman of Board Mr. Amr Hassan Elmaayirgy. The school is a co-educational school that serves grades Pre-Kindergarten through Secondary. There are three different educational systems in the school: the National Division, the British Division and the American Division. The British Division is from years 1 to 12, the American Division, which was first established in September 2001 serves Pre-K through Grade 12.

The Modern Education American School received an overwhelmingly positive overall assessment in its third periodic accreditation from AdvancED in May 2012. The school received the highest rating “Highly Functional” in 5 out of 7 standards,and for the other two standards the school was rated as “Operational” which is the second best rating. These high ratings are awarded to very few schools worldwide. The qualifying team was impressed with the school’s high quality of education, as well as its strong culture.
It is worth mentioning that MES received its first AdvanceED accreditation (known as CITA at that time) in August 2001 and Again in May 2007 as part of the customary accreditation review process every 5 years.
